Luke Nicholson

Originally from Lakefield, Ontario, Luke Nicholson had his first major breakthrough in 2007, when the track “Breathe” from the film Poor Boys Game earned a Genienomination for Best Original Song. Nicholson’s debut album Mad Love, debuted on 2012, which spawned three CBC Radio 2 Top 20 singles and earned glowing reviews in Europe, most notably from Rolling Stone Germany who described Nicholson as a “young Elton John or Billy Joel.
